Phenotypic Data
Phenotypic Class
Phenotype Manifest In
Detailed Description
Statement
Reference

10% of mutant males raised at 18-22[o]C through the first or second larval instar stages and then shifted to 28[o]C prior to pupal development have an under-rotated genitalia phenotype. The frequency of rotation defects is reduced if the flies are reared at 22[o]C.

Strong allele.

Genetic Interactions
Statement
Reference

100% of mysb13 if3 double mutant males have under-rotated genitalia at 22[o]C, with 61% of them being greater than 180[o] under-rotated.
